How to ask your stylist for this hairstyle 

Tips

Find a colorist who is a curl specialist with a strong portfolio of healthy blonde results on Type 3/4 hair. Ask for a "blonde afro" and have a deep consultation about health, toner shades (e.g., "honey blonde," not "ash blonde"), and a long-term care plan.

Will going blonde ruin my 3C curl pattern?

It is a significant risk. Bleach is a powerful chemical that can loosen your curl pattern. A skilled colorist who uses bond-building treatments (like Olaplex) and a gentle lightener can minimize the damage, but some change is possible. Meticulous aftercare is essential.
